Replacement Double Glazing Window HandlesIt is important to replace a damaged double-glazed window handle to ensure safety and efficiency.uPVC handles are controlled by a spindle that is inserted through the middle of the handle to the lock mechanism within the window frame.You’ll have to be aware of the step height for your uPVC handle, which is determined by looking for screw cover caps on the inside of the handle.Tilt & TurnIn Europe tilt and turn windows are an increasingly popular choice. However they are only now making an impact in the UK. These windows are a favorite option for renovations as well as new constructions due to their high-end functionality. They are simple to close or open which allows light and air into your home.The locking points on the sash and the rubber seal that wraps around the entire frame perimeter makes them more airtight than other types of windows. Unlike uPVC casement windows, tilt and turn windows are opened from both sides and allow you to clean the outside of windows from inside your home.If you are replacing a tilt and turn window handle it is important to consider the step height of your handle. This is the distance between the handle’s base and the point at which it is attached to your window frame. It is essential to do this correctly as otherwise your window will not be able to open properly.Standard step heights for UPVC and aluminium tilt-and-turn windows are 21mm. To ensure that your new handle is compatible with the window, make sure it is of the same step height.Another aspect to keep in mind when choosing the tilt and turn replacement window handle is the type of operation it offers. Some handles have an opening lever that is locked when it is down and up at 90 degrees to tilt and straight up to open. This is known as a “tilt before turn” (TBT) safe handle. You should utilize this feature when children are in your home.The majority of tilt and turn windows will have a spindle at the handle’s back that can be adjusted to various locations, similar to a door lock. The length of the spindle can also vary. Some spindles have a larger diameter that can be adjusted with an screwdriver. Some have a shorter shaft that can be adjusted only by loosening the small screw at base of handle.CasementCasement windows are extremely popular for a variety of reasons. If you have difficulty opening your windows, it could be because the spindle in the handle is worn out.When you are replacing your uPVC casement window handles there are a few things to keep in mind. Included in this are the size of the handle, screw centres, and spindle sizes. Consider the lock type as well as the color. The kind of handle you select will determine the mechanism used to lock your window.Today’s uPVC windows are equipped with Espag handles. These handles control the espagnolette multipoint locks that are installed on your uPVC windows. The handles are available in different colours and in locking or unlocking versions. They are available in left and right opening options.Cockspur handles can still be present on older uPVC double-glazed windows but these handles are no longer in use. These handles differ from their aluminium equivalent in that they have an additional step height. They are typically 21mm, whereas the aluminium version is 9mm.You can also use blades or spade handles as replacement handles for double-glazed windows. These handles are similar to cockspur handles, however they have a smaller spindle. They are usually found on older wooden frame double glazed windows, however they can also be found on some uPVC cottage windows.SashIf you have a traditional sash window, you might require replacement sash double glazing window handles for it.
